@extends('layouts.app') @section('title', 'Penugasan Sekolah ke Pengawas - Admin KCD') @section('content')

Penugasan Sekolah ke Pengawas

Kelola penugasan pengawas ke sekolah di wilayah KCD Anda

@if(session('success')) @endif @if(session('error')) @endif
Total Sekolah

{{ $stats['total_schools'] }}

Di KCD ini
Sudah Tertugaskan

{{ $stats['assigned_schools'] }}

Memiliki pengawas
Belum Tertugaskan

{{ $stats['unassigned_schools'] }}

Perlu pengawas
Pengawas Aktif

{{ $stats['active_supervisors'] }}

Di KCD ini
Daftar Pengawas dan Sekolah Binaannya
@if($supervisorGroups->isEmpty())

Belum ada pengawas yang ditugaskan

Klik tombol "Penugasan Baru" untuk menugaskan pengawas ke sekolah

@else @foreach($supervisorGroups as $supervisorData) @php $colors = ['primary', 'success', 'warning', 'info', 'danger']; $colorIndex = $loop->index % count($colors); $employee = $supervisorData['employee']; $schools = $supervisorData['schools']; $initials = collect(explode(' ', $employee->name)) ->map(fn($word) => strtoupper(substr($word, 0, 1))) ->take(2) ->join(''); @endphp
{{ $initials }}
{{ $employee->name }}
@if($employee->nip) NIP: {{ $employee->nip }} @endif @if($employee->email) | {{ $employee->email }} @endif @if($employee->phone) | {{ $employee->phone }} @endif
Sekolah Binaan ({{ $schools->count() }}):
@foreach($schools as $school) {{ $school->name }} @endforeach
@endforeach @endif
Sekolah Belum Tertugaskan
@if($schoolsWithoutSupervisor->count() > 0)
@foreach($schoolsWithoutSupervisor as $school) @endforeach
Nama Sekolah Kepala Sekolah Kab/Kota
{{ $school->name }}
NPSN: {{ $school->npsn }}
{{ $school->principal_name ?? '-' }} {{ $school->kabKota->name ?? '-' }}
@else

Semua sekolah sudah memiliki pengawas!

@endif
@endsection